How they compare
Mali currently reports 80,660 t against 77,382 t in Costa Rica, a difference of 3,278 t.
The two have swapped places 9 times across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Costa Rica ahead.
Costa Rica ranks 76th and Mali ranks 75th of 186 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Costa Rica averaged higher in 5 and Mali in 2.

About this data
The Cropland Nutrient balance domain contains information on the flows of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ium from mineral fertilizer, manure applied, atmospheric deposition, crop removal, and biological fixation over cropland and per unit area of cropland. The flows are aggregated to total inputs and total outputs, from which the overall nutrient balance and nutrient use efficiency on cropland are calculated. Statistics are disseminated in units of tonnes and in kg/ha, as appropriate. Nutrient use efficiency is expressed as a fraction (%).
